The power delivery is interesting - it pulls very strongly from 2.5K up to 6K, which is where I would normally change up, but it goes totally mental up to the 8.2K redline if you keep your foot down. The box is lovely - very positive changes and not too notchy even from cold. I had them change the gearbox oil before delivery so that may have helped. LSD makes it's presence known in no uncertain terms in low speed corners & when manoeuvring - sounds like the 'box is about to fall out :lol:

As to the 4WD / PSM vs 2WD and no PSM, I can't really say I've noticed that much of a difference, but it has been dry so far :wink:

The biggest differences are how much steering feedback there is, the brakes(!) and the LSD. Negatives are that there's currently too much understeer and I find myself applying power oversteer to compensate - this is something that needs a trip to JZ Machtech to get them to sort the geometry out ASAP.
